New online community connects FCCLA’s alumni and associates

For Immediate Release
Monday, July 14, 2008

Family, Career and Community Leaders of America (FCCLA), a national student organization, launched an interactive web site from Alumni Channel for its two million alumni and associates (A&A).   FCCLA alumni and associates, as well as advisers and university professors, now have a dedicated online community space from Alumni Channel, a provider of hosted, online communities for schools and other non-profits.

At an Alumni & Associates reception held today at FCCLA’s annual National Leadership Meeting in Orlando, the site was revealed to over 200 in attendance at the reception.  Scores of interested alumni also made visits to the FCCLA A&A booth in the exhibit hall over the three day meeting for additional information and to sign up.

Similar to Facebook and MySpace, and taglined “A community for FCCLA / FHA / NHA / HERO Alumni & Associates,” the FCCLA Alumni & Associates online community gives members multiple opportunities for networking. These range from member profiles and message boards for staying in touch with FCCLA past officers and advisers, to news about alumni; FCCLA-sponsored, events; and professional development opportunities. “We created this new site to foster a greater sense of community among FCCLA alumni and associates and connect them to other young people who share the same passion for leadership and family,” said Leslie Shields, Communications and Alumni Coordinator for FCCLA.  Goals for the community include mentor programs, online interaction, and a message board of job opportunities.  FCCLA decided to partner with Alumni Channel in order to go “above and beyond” when it came to communicating with A&A members.

About FCCLA

FCCLA: The Ultimate Leadership Experience is a dynamic and effective national student organization that helps young men and women become leaders and address important personal, family, work, and societal issues through Family and Consumer Sciences Education. FCCLA has more than 220,000 members and nearly 7,000 chapters from 50 state associations and the District of Columbia, Puerto Rico, and the Virgin Islands. The organization has involved more than ten million youth since its founding in 1945.

Family, Career and Community Leaders of America is unique among youth organizations because its programs are planned and run by members. It is the only career and technical in-school student organization with the family as its central focus. Participation in national programs and chapter activities helps members become strong leaders in their families, careers, and communities.  FCCLA is located in Reston, Virginia.  For more information, visit www.FCCLAinc.org.

About Alumni Channel

Alumni Channel online alumni communities are designed to increase alumni connections through a secure online alumni directory that will help connect an organization’s entire membership.  Alumni Channel offers alumni a community of their own to contact each other, plan reunions, share stories and photos, and it enables the parent organization (e.g. school, club, team, foundation, district) to maintain and build an alumni database with valuable alumni contact information.  Organizations have the ability to not only announce upcoming events and campaigns on the site itself, but also customize and send mass e-mails, run reports, export data and distribute surveys. Founded in 1998, Alumni Channel is headquartered in Cherry Hill, New Jersey.  For more information, visit www.alumnichannel.com.
